Introduction

In the hyper-competitive online retail space, Minimum Advertised Price (MAP) enforcement has become a cornerstone for protecting brand equity and distributor relationships. This case study explores how a well-known New York-based consumer electronics brand partnered with Actowiz Metrics to monitor, detect, and reduce MAP violations across platforms like Amazon, Walmart, eBay, and Newegg, achieving a 34% reduction in violations within three months.

The Client
The client is a mid-size electronics brand based in New York City, distributing through a network of resellers, affiliates, and third-party marketplaces. Their products include:

Bluetooth speakers
Smart home devices
Charging stations
Wireless headphones
Despite having MAP agreements in place, the brand noticed frequent underpricing by unauthorized sellers, hurting authorized dealer sales and customer trust.

Challenges Faced

Lack of Visibility Across Marketplaces: The client was blind to who was undercutting prices on third-party marketplaces.
High Volume of Violations: With 300+ SKUs, ...
... manual checks were impossible. Sellers changed prices frequently.
Delayed Detection: By the time they noticed a violation, the damage was already done.
Brand Erosion: Retail partners complained about unequal pricing and pulled out of MAP compliance.

Solution by Actowiz Metrics
Actowiz Metrics deployed an AI-enabled eCommerce Price Monitoring System that:
Scraped product pricing data every 2 hours from:
Amazon US (Seller Central + Buy Box + 3P)
Walmart.com
eBay.com
Newegg.com
Mapped SKUs, GTINs, ASINs with real-time price tracking.
Identified unauthorized sellers via reverse lookup.
Triggered violation alerts based on a defined MAP price threshold.
Delivered reports via dashboard and daily email exports.
